R&D, i.e. Research & Development, is a whole process that includes basic theory research, technology research, products development and marketing development. The Chinese mainland has become a hot spot to attract investment of medical transnational corporations in research and development in recent years along with the rapid economic growth and opening the outside world. A number of world-famous transnational medical corporations began to establish research and development institutes in China one after another.The paper analyzes the background, the traits, and the development trends of foreign-founded institutes of medical transnational corporations in China. It also reviews the theories about foreign-founded institutes of transnational corporations in research and development. One of them is the traditional FDI theories, such as the specific advantage theory, the product cycle theory, the internal theory and the eclectic theory of international production. The other is new theories, such as the strategic investment theory, the need- resource theory, the theory of R&D centralization and decentralization, the home-based exploiting or augmenting theory, and complimentary assets framework, etc.The paper analyzes the motivation of foreign-founded R&D institute in China with the need-resource theory. As a new emerging market, there are so many opportunities in Chinese medical market that the transnational medical corporations try to move in the Chinese medical marketing. There have a great potential of the demand of medicines and drugs with the rapid growth of economic and the total and aged population in China. On the other hand, the transnational medical corporations can take advantage of the Chinese better resources, such as the excellent and cheaper human resource, the low cost in research and development, the encouraged and preferential policies provided by Chinese government, and the plentiful Chinese medicine resource etc. At the same time, the paper analyzes the positive and negative influence on China by foreign-founded R&D institute. In the end, the paper gives some reference advice and suggestions to the government to face the challenge of foreign-founded R&D institute. The government should improve the investment environment by making proper policies. Moreover, the paper also gives what countermeasures Chinese medical corporations should take to improve their competence. It states that the Chinese medical corporations should make a full use of their own comparative advantage to take an active part in the global competition with the medical transnational corporations.
